Happy Birthday, Robert McCloskey!
Today is Robert McCloskey's birthday. He would have been 96 today.
Robert McCloskey tops my list of favorite children's book illustrators of all time. His drawings are simply perfect. His line work is so confident that his illustrations appear effortless. He masterfully captured gesture and mood in every picture. Today I'm shipping off the last of the artwork for my next book, Learning to Ski with Mr. Magee. The publisher is Chronicle Books and it will be released this Fall/Winter.
It's always a good feeling to finish up a book and send it off, but a lot of people don't realize that it takes nearly a year from the time I send in the finals to when the book is released!
